The quantity you could borrow that have a beneficial HELOC relies upon several products, for instance the property value your property, the fresh new percentage of you to worth the lending company can help you borrow against, and exactly how far you owe on your own home loan

To acquire an idea of everything might be able to obtain having a HELOC, you should use one or two brief calculations. First, multiply your residence’s newest well worth of the percentage of worthy of the newest lender can help you obtain. The end result is the maximum level of security that’ll https://paydayloansconnecticut.com/waterbury/ become borrowed. 2nd, deduct the remaining equilibrium on the financial regarding one to add up to get the full amount you could acquire.

Eg, for those who have property well worth $3 hundred,000 having a balance out of $200,000 on the first mortgage as well as your lender will allow you to view to 85% of your home’s worth, you might acquire around $255,000 when you look at the security. Subtracting the total amount you still owe in your mortgage ($two hundred,000) would give your a total count you can use having a good HELOC off $55,000.

It is vital to remember that lenders have more limitations to your exactly how much you could potentially obtain that have an excellent HELOC. Specific can get restrict your borrowing limit to help you 80% of the residence’s value, although some can get allow you to use doing 90%.

To acquire a very right estimate away from just how much you can acquire having a good HELOC, you can use a great HELOC calculator. These calculators take into account factors such as your house’s worthy of, your credit rating, along with your CLTV (combined financing-to-value) proportion to provide a very perfect imagine of borrowing from the bank stamina.

To order A good Foreclosed Home: Threats vs. Advantages

Over the past construction home foreclosures almost tripled, because this 2009 article of CNN Money records. A residential property dealers strolled for the sector and you may scooped upwards foreclosed property to possess a lot less than the owners got originally paid down. It turned all of them with the rental belongings and, in the event that housing marketplace increased, investors sold them to possess generous profits.

Whenever a property owner doesn’t shell out property taxes and/or home loan, regional governing bodies otherwise loan providers begin a property foreclosure process to forcibly and obtain possession of the homes and improvements in order to mitigate the loss. The definition of property foreclosure is the judge procedure for which a property is repossessed-generally speaking because of the a bank otherwise state government organization.

Know very well what you get toward with a great foreclosed domestic

Whenever a homeowner is not able to make mortgage repayments this new bank forecloses to your-or takes right back-our home. You can find four standard measures to the domestic foreclosures process:

  1. Pre-foreclosure: where resident receives notice off a beneficial pending property foreclosure action, however the financial has not yet yet started to foreclose.
  2. Lender foreclosure techniques: lender initiate the brand new court way to foreclose to the domestic, for the amount of time and you will specific tips different out-of condition to state.
  3. Bank seizes the house and you may evicts this new homeowner: by this point the latest homeowner have always given up the house, either taking together with them to they can hold appliances, plumbing work fixtures, lighting fixtures, and much more.
  4. Lender offers our home because the a foreclosed https://paydayloanalabama.com/waverly/ property or holds up until industry enhances: unless of course a bona fide house individual can make a take on this new lender in advance, our home is offered at the a property foreclosure market otherwise kept because Home Owned till the market improves.
